设R和S分别为r和s元关系,且R有n个元组,s有m个元组,执行关系R和S的笛卡尔积,记作T=R×S,则

admin2010-07-20  26

问题 设R和S分别为r和s元关系,且R有n个元组,s有m个元组,执行关系R和S的笛卡尔积,记作T=R×S,则

选项 A、T是一个具有n+m个元组的r+s元的关系
B、T是一个具有n×m个元组的r×s元的关系
C、T是一个具有m+n个元组的r×s元的关系
D、T是一个具有n×m个元组的r+s元的关系

答案D

解析 设R和s分别为r元和s元的关系,定义R和S的笛卡尔积是一个(r+s)元元组的集合,每一个元组的前r个分量来自R的一个元组,后s个分量来自s的一个元组。若R有k1个元组,S有k2个元组,则关系R和关系s的笛卡尔积有k1×k2个元组。记作:R×s={t|t=<tr,ts>∧tr∈R∧ts)。
转载请注明原文地址:https://kaotiyun.com/show/vGvZ777K
0

最新回复(0)